How an Automated Compliance Questionnaire Works

A modern questionnaire flow usually works like an interview. It asks one question at a time, shows follow-up questions based on earlier responses, collects documents, and routes completed submissions for review.

What Good Compliance Automation Software Should Include

Good compliance automation software should do more than capture answers. It should help identify clauses, entities, and metadata, score risks, summarize issues, and move records into review workflows.

Common Use Cases

Automated Compliance Questionnaires
Useful when a business needs consistent answers from clients, partners, departments, or third parties in a structured format.
Vendor Compliance Questionnaire Automation
Supports onboarding by collecting policy acknowledgements, certifications, legal declarations, and supporting evidence.
Security Compliance Questionnaire Automation
Standardizes security reviews by collecting responses about controls, policies, risk handling, and supporting documentation.
Compliance Assessment Automation
Turns internal or external compliance checks into repeatable workflows with validation and review logic.

FAQ

1. What is compliance questionnaire automation?
It is the process of turning manual compliance forms into structured digital interviews that collect answers, documents, and review-ready data.
2. How is it different from a normal form?
A normal form is static. An automated compliance questionnaire can use rules, branching logic, validation, and review routing.
3. Can it be used for vendor and security reviews?
Yes. It can support vendor onboarding, policy checks, security reviews, and other structured compliance assessments.
4. Why is branching logic important?
Branching logic helps ask only relevant follow-up questions, which improves accuracy and reduces unnecessary back-and-forth.
